Why Robinhood (HOOD) Shares Are Falling Today

What Happened? Shares of financial services company Robinhood (NASDAQ:HOOD) fell 6.7% in the morning session after its third-quarter 2025 results, despite beating revenue and earnings estimates, were overshadowed by concerns about its future profit outlook and the announced retirement of its Chief Financial Officer (CFO).
